  • AA: use #c733ba as the text (4.61:1)
  • AAA: use #d96dd0 as the text (7.05:1)
  • AA: or shift the background to #969696 (4.55:1)
  • AAA: or shift the background to #bdbdbd (7.16:1)

Fixes keep hue and saturation and move lightness only, so the suggestion stays on-brand. Ratios are symmetric: the same numbers apply with #51154c as the background.
